Content of a Nevada Sample Letter for Request to Waive Bank Fee: 1. Introduction: — Address the letter to the appropriate bank representative. — Clearly state the purpose of the letter and identify yourself or your business. 2. Explanation of the Fee: — Describe the bank fee in question (state amount, date, account information, etc.). — Briefly explain the circumstances or events leading to the imposition of the fee. 3. Reasons for Waiver: — Provide detailed and valid reasons justifying the request for fee waiver. — Include any extraordinary circumstances, financial hardships, or unexpected events that occurred. 4. Demonstration of Loyalty or Financial Commitment: — If applicable, highlight your loyalty as a long-term customer or the financial commitments you have made with the bank. — Showcase your satisfactory banking history and adherence to the terms and conditions. 5. Proposed Solution or Adjustment: — Suggest possible alternatives such as fee reduction, settlement, or adjusting the fee reasonably. 6. Closing: — Express gratitude for the bank's consideration and mention your willingness to discuss the matter further if required. — Include relevant contact information.
